2021 CAFTCAD Awards Show

For over a decade, the Canadian Alliance of Film and Television Costume Arts and Design (CAFTCAD) has worked towards bringing together Canadian costume professionals from all corners of the industry, regardless of union affiliation. The CAFTCAD Awards, which held its inaugural event in 2019, is the culmination of these efforts to bring the costuming community together, recognize and reward talent, and usher CAFTCAD onto the world stage.

 
 

This year we celebrate faculty member Anthea Mallinson and her CapU alumni team (listed below) who won the Excellence in Textiles award on Saturday, May 1, 2021, at the 2021 Canadian Alliance for Film and Television Costume Arts and Design (CAFTCAD) ceremony for their work on the TV series β€œThe Chilling Adventures of Sabrina.”
